The market helps users print documents and images remotely through internet-connected devices without need direct physical connection to printing hardware. This technology uses cloud computing infrastructure to make possible seamless printing experiences in multiple devices, including smartphones, tablets, laptops, and desktop computer. Cloud printing solutions include different deployment models, including public, private, and hybrid cloud environments, catering to different organizational requirements ranging from small businesses to large enterprises.
The market also includes different service types such as email-to-print, web-based printing, mobile printing applications, and enterprise-grade printing management systems. Key technological components driving this market include wireless connectivity protocols, cloud storage integration, print management software, and security frameworks ensuring data protection during transmission. The popularity of remote work culture, digital transformation initiatives, and increasing adoption of mobile devices has added to the demand for flexible printing solutions. Major industry players are continuously innovating to improve user experience through improved print quality, faster processing speeds, security features, and smooth integration with popular cloud platforms.
The global cloud printing market is primarily driven by the accelerating digital transformation across industries, which has fundamentally altered workplace dynamics and created unprecedented demand for flexible, location-independent printing solutions. The exponential growth of remote work arrangements, particularly accelerated by recent global events, has necessitated seamless access to printing capabilities from various locations, driving organizations to adopt cloud-based printing infrastructure that supports distributed workforces.
However, the market faces significant restraints, particularly concerning data security and privacy concerns, as organizations remain hesitant to transmit sensitive documents through cloud networks due to potential cybersecurity threats and regulatory compliance requirements. Nevertheless, substantial opportunities emerge from the growing adoption of Internet of Things (IoT) technologies and smart office concepts, which enable advanced printing automation and intelligent document management. The increasing focus on sustainability and environmental consciousness drives the demand for cloud printing solutions that optimize resource utilization and reduce paper waste through intelligent print management features.
